WebMay 25, 2024 · Open Finder. It’s the two-toned smiling face on the Dock, which is usually at the bottom of the screen. 2 Navigate to the TGZ file. If you downloaded it from the internet, it may be located in your Downloads folder. 3 Double-click the TGZ file. Depending on how the file was zipped, this may be all you need to do. WebFeb 5, 2024 · The tar options are as follows to extract tgz file in Linux: -x : Extract file. -z : Deal with compressed file i.e. filter the archive through gzip. -v : Verbose output i.e. show progress. -f : File, work on data.tgz file. -C /path/to/dir/ : Extract files in /path/to/dir/ directory instead of the current directory on Linux.
